Head of Compliance

A growing specialty insurance business is seeking an experienced Head of Compliance to lead compliance activity across the UK and EU. This role combines hands-on oversight with strategic responsibility, supporting the business as it continues to expand internationally.

You will act as the primary contact for regulatory matters, ensuring ongoing compliance with FCA requirements and relevant EU regulatory frameworks.

Key Responsibilities

  • Maintain and enhance compliance policies, procedures, and governance frameworks

  • Interpret and implement FCA regulations, including Consumer Duty, SMCR, conduct rules, and financial crime requirements

  • Oversee EU regulatory obligations across multiple jurisdictions (e.g. IDD, GDPR, sanctions)

  • Act as the main liaison with the FCA, EU regulators, and support audits

  • Lead compliance monitoring, file reviews, delegated authority oversight, and MI reporting

  • Oversee AML/CTF, sanctions, PEP checks, and fraud risk controls

  • Review TOBAs and advise the business on regulatory matters, products, and cross-border activity

  • Deliver compliance training and promote a strong compliance culture

  • Ensure GDPR and data protection compliance across all operations

Skills & Experience

  • Bachelor’s degree or equivalent

  • Professional insurance or compliance qualifications preferred

  • Strong background in insurance compliance (MGA or broker preferred; carrier considered)

  • In-depth knowledge of UK and EU regulatory frameworks

  • Ability to operate strategically and hands-on in a dynamic environment

  • Excellent communication and stakeholder management skills
